Output d0006764425976fa1e8362e6ec0df6028568ff106ea21dd95c54cd29a401e6e6:6

value
38521988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9fc38bcc35a66dbd4a1ba11ccc44e9043a0c1c4 OP_EQUAL
address
MVEMpnw9vgeJ4dhXzvoKd7wsCbTzVr6Ao8
transaction
d0006764425976fa1e8362e6ec0df6028568ff106ea21dd95c54cd29a401e6e6
spent
true